555-81168e90ee61a2237

555-81168e90ee61a2237.jpeg hosted at HQ Pics Space - Celebrity Photos Catalog

1920 × 908 — JPEG 601.9 KB

Added to Michelle Rodriguez Italy... 1 year ago — 18 views

No description provided.